This ski-to-door Whistler property is located at the bottom of Blackcomb Mountain on the free shuttle route. Each suite features a fully equipped kitchen and free Wi-Fi. Skiers Plaza is 1.2 mi away. The Horstma ... Read more

View all Luxury Hotels in Whistler (BC)